A basic fried rice that makes a great side dish or add the meat of your choice for an all-in-one meal. Ingredients:
1 cup brown rice |
2 cups water |
1 tbsp chicken bouillon |
1/3 cup carrots, chopped |
1/3 cup onion, chopped |
1/4 cup green peas, frozen |
1 tablespoon sesame oil |
1 egg |
2 tbsp soy sauce or oyster sauce |
Directions:
1. In a saucepan, combine rice, water, and bouillon and stir well.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at, cover, and simmer for 20 minutes. 2. In a small saucepan, boil carrots in water about 3 to 5 minutes. Drop peas into boiling water, and drain. 3. Heat wok over high heat. Pour in oil, saute onion, stir in carrots and peas; cook about 30 seconds. Crack in eggs, stirring quickly to scramble eggs with vegetables. Stir in cooked rice. Shake in soy sauce, and toss rice to coat. |
